The Global Waste-to-Energy (WTE) Industry involves processes that convert non-recyclable municipal solid waste (MSW) and other waste streams into usable forms of energy, such as electricity, heat, or fuel. This market is pivotal in solving two major global challenges simultaneously: managing the exponential increase in urban waste volumes and transitioning to sustainable energy sources.
The growth is primarily driven by strict environmental regulations regarding landfill use, the need for diversified energy portfolios, and governmental policies promoting renewable energy targets. WTE facilities, while requiring significant initial investment, offer a more environmentally friendly alternative to traditional incineration and landfilling, significantly reducing greenhouse gas emissions and the volume of waste requiring final disposal. Market Size and Robust Growth Projections
The Waste-to-Energy Market exhibits stable and continuous growth, fueled by global urbanization trends and advancements in thermal and biological conversion technologies.
The market size was robustly valued at USD 36.64 Billion in 2024. Projections indicate a strong upward trajectory, anticipating the market will reach USD 59.28 Billion by 2032. This steady expansion corresponds to a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 6.20% during the forecast period of 2025 to 2032.

Segmentation Analysis: Diversified Conversion Technologies
The WTE market is segmented based on the technologies used for energy conversion and the source of the waste material.
By Technology
Thermal Technologies: This segment, which includes Incineration (Mass Burn), Gasification, and Pyrolysis, currently holds the largest share. Incineration remains the most common method globally for generating electricity from waste.
Biological Technologies: This includes Anaerobic Digestion (AD), which processes organic waste to produce biogas (methane), and Fermentation, used to create liquid fuels like ethanol. This segment is expected to see faster growth due to the focus on organic waste separation and renewable fuel mandates.
By Source of Waste
The primary source is Municipal Solid Waste (MSW), which is the heterogeneous waste generated by households and businesses. Other sources include industrial waste, agricultural waste, and hazardous waste, each requiring specialized WTE processes.
